Transaction 7daf43e3b979793682321ab7ce609889bc7357275429590a04a852381d372b21
1 Input
1 Output
-
7daf43e3b979793682321ab7ce609889bc7357275429590a04a852381d372b21:0
- value
- 98656
- script pubkey
- OP_0 OP_PUSHBYTES_20 68b01a88dd9d5b7161dd77fb0660a17fa91fe470
- address
- bc1qdzcp4zxan4dhzcwawlasvc9p0753lersx37te4